Guram Tskhovrebov

Guram Yasonovich Tskhovrebov (Georgian: გურამ ცხოვრებოვი; Russian: Гурам Ясонович Цховребов; 14 July 1938 in Tskhinvali 1998) was a Soviet football player.

International career

Tskhovrebov made his debut for USSR on 28 July 1967 in a 1968 Summer Olympics qualifier against Poland. He also played in UEFA Euro 1968 qualifiers, but was not selected for the final tournament squad.
